Laurente beats Saulong by UD
By Lito delos Reyes PhilBoxing.com Sat, 20 Mar 2021

DAVAO CITY – Criztian Pitt “Golden Boy” Laurente of Gen. Santos City remained undefeated after he beat former world title challenger Ernesto Saulong of Mindoro Occidental by a unanimous decision today in Biñan City, Laguna.
The 21-year-old Laurente of the Peñalosa Boxing Gym, used his hit and turn around on the right side to avoid a possible retaliation by Saulong.
It was always the same style by Laurente but was effective against Saulong, who got frustrated as he was not able to hit back against Laurente.
It was only in the 5th round that Saulong landed several blows against Laurente. But Laurente went back to his plan against Saulong in the next three rounds.
Judges Fernando Batistil and Al Llaneta scored at 77-75 while Judge Salvador Lopez had it 78-74 all in favor of Laurente.
Laurente remained undefeated with six wins and three knockouts while the 31-year-old Saulong, a former WBC International bantamweight title, suffered his seventh loss against 22 wins and two draws.
Meanwhile, undefeated Kenneth Llover knocked out Jemark Gandao in the 1st of round while minimumweight Harry Omac hit an overhead in 1st round to stop Mike Grondiano by a TKO.
The bubble boxing card was presented by Gerry “Fearless” Peñalosa of the Gerrpens Promotions Inc. and sponsored by Casino Filipino and Pagcor with the cooperation of Kosuke Washio, Blackwater, Elito and the Games and Amusements Board.
